Nutri Fit Cruise
Fina Vendrell Vila
Mens sana in corpore sano. (Yuvenal)
Abstract
This article describes an eTwinning project carried out in three participating countries: Catalonia,
Greece and Poland. A ship sails across the “eTwinning sea” and stops at several different islands.
There we learn about how to keep our minds and bodies healthy. This project is a practical
example of a cross-curricular, interdisciplinary project, the methodology of which involves the
development of key competences and can be characterized as innovative, collaborative, cross-
curricular, project-based and motivational. This methodology was supported by ICT and had a
focus on student-centred, personalized learning. The project was a good way to involve students
and motivate them through learning by doing. It also demonstrated that we can work well by
opening our school doors and letting Europe into the classroom!
Introduction
Crew members from three different countries lived aboard the Nutri Fit ship as a big family.
People with different languages, traditions and cultures lived together and shared the same goals
of just having fun and learning a lot at the same time. All the activities were developed in a
cooperative and collaborative way, and in the adventure students improved their English and used
lots of new web 2.0 tools.
Curricula integration, innovation and creativity
The subject and the aim of the project were closely connected with the school curriculum and the
education program. Pupils improved their English level, especially their communication skills in it
because this language was used as the main language for their international communication. The
children also developed their ICT abilities while working on new programs and using modern ICT
tools. They could expand their talents in writing recipes and books, cooking, acting or taking part
in advertisements. The children demonstrated their huge creativity in painting, drawing and
making works of art during Arts and Crafts lessons. Music lessons helped them to sing the
anthem. They appreciated the role of physical exercises during PE lessons. The children’s
awareness of the nutritional importance of fruit and vegetables and the significant role of bees
increased their Science knowledge.

The topic of this interdisciplinary project combined education and educational aims in a very
appealing way. All the activities were focussed on healthy habits. The students learnt how to lead
a healthy life and do physical exercise regularly. The project taught the children tolerance towards
people from other countries and supported their respect for the elderly. Cooperation with parents
and the local community is also included in the school’s educational role. To summarize, NFC
was a multidisciplinary project, where different multiple intelligences and key competences were
developed and improved throughout it.
Communication, collaboration and exchange between partner schools
Positive cooperation, mutual help and the exchange of experiences enabled the teachers to
overcome problems connected with using modern communication and information technologies.
Pupils cooperated and shared experiences very willingly. The exchange of views in a foreign
language by using chats, video conferences through Adobe Connect, email and forums was a new
experience for some of them. Conducted video conferences are an example of direct
communication between children. Writing a simultaneous story and performing it, writing lyrics
for the anthem using Meetingwords and singing it all together, or contributing to the transnational
Padlets are also good examples of sharing their cooperative work.
None of the activities could have been carried out without the collaboration and the involvement
of the three countries. Most of the collaborative activity results had a tangible outcome: a play, an
e-book, a common anthem, dynamic meals, etc.
Use of technology
New ways of thinking, working, and living in the world are moulding the framework of our 21st
century. Technologies are changing our way of learning, and they allow us to work collaboratively
and develop our skills and competences. So, our thinking in this project was, “Let’s take
advantage of them!”
The use of web tools in the project was consistent in all the phases to ensure success and the
attainment of pedagogical objectives. It's amazing how rewarding it is for all of us to use new
web2.0 tools. Pupils had a challenge: to develop their knowledge and abilities by using modern
information technology. They were willing to learn new tools to present their material on
Twinspace. Some of them were able to communicate in a foreign language through eTwinning
Live and Twinspace for the first time. They also learnt how to use many tools in a clever and
creative way such as: Padlet, Storyjumper, Smilebox, Kizoa, Kahoot, Wordle, AnswerGarden,
Calaméo (eSafety issues were taken into account, as well as copyright issues), Prezi, Picture Trail,
PowerPoint, video conferencing through Adobe Connect, vokis, blogging, Google Docs, Studio
Audacity, Freepuzzlemaker, HotPotatoes, TitanPad, Babblerize, VideoScribe, Tagxedo, and the
interactive whiteboard. The variety and large amount of web tools used in this project were
interesting and attractive. All of them are uploaded on a Symbaloo page on Twinspace in order to
be public and shared by anyone who needs them.
The teachers in the three countries learnt from one another, as did the pupils. Our cooperative way
of working helped us to improve our teaching skills a lot!

Results, impact and documentation
The project raised pupils’ awareness that people of different nationalities and cultures also want to
lead a healthy lifestyle, and they live next to us: different people - the same desires. The teachers
managed to create the final effect (a Nutri Fit Walk) based on the participation of students,
teachers and parents, which allows one to consider the approach to this subject in a holistic way.
The project is an example of an innovative way of teaching English. It activated pupils and
motivated them, and it developed their industriousness and creative thinking.
All the activities in our project are appropriate for any school, any place and any language. The
project’s impact was important, given the fact that it went beyond the school gates and reached all
the families in the community through communication via the web, the school’s blog and the town
media.
Awards
Nutri Fit Cruise won numerous awards. It received three National Quality labels: from Spain,
Greece and Poland. It was also given a European Quality label. In addition, it won the 1st National
eTwinning prize in the 11th National Competition in Greece, in October 2016, along with the 1st
National Prize in Poland. The three teachers coordinating the project, Angeliki Kougiourouki in
Greece, Irena Glowinska in Poland, and myself, enjoyed ourselves immensely and learnt a great
deal from each other. Participating in eTwinning allows teachers and students from all over
Europe to find a way to work as a great team, to get involved and motivated, while we all become
more creative and gain more positive values towards society and the world.
